Utah Code Ann. § 77-11c-102 — Retention of evidence as an exhibit.

(1) If evidence is admitted as an exhibit for a court proceeding, the clerk of the court shall: (1)(a) retain the evidence; or (1)(b) return the evidence to the custody of the agency. (2) Rule 4-206 of the Utah Code of Judicial Administration applies to evidence that is admitted as an exhibit in a court proceeding.
